WebFeb 9, 2024 · Here’s what you do: Soak the balls in a bucket with water (either warm or lukewarm) and some kind of mild detergent, like Dawn or Palmolive. After 5 minutes, remove the balls, rinse them off, and dry them with a microfiber cloth. WebNov 28, 2024 · The best way to remove dust from the pockets is with the hose extension from a vacuum or a shop-vac. Dust and debris that have accumulated in the pockets can get on the billiard balls and transfer dirt and grime to the felt during game play. WebA sponge, soft lean cloth, a gentle soap, and warm water, with a bit of pressure, are all you’ll need to clean those balls. Following washing the stains, make sure the ball is free of any washing residue. Any remaining detergent on the ball might create a shimmery residue. WebStep 2: Get Cleaning! Soaking your pool balls for some time will help loosen any dirt buildup on their surface, making the cleaning process much easier. Then, you can easily scrub each pool ball with a microfiber towel or soft-bristled brush.
